Adapting to Industry Trends: How Roll Forming Machines are Shaping the Future of Steel Decking

Analyze industry trends, such as the rise in prefabricated construction, and show how roll forming machines enable manufacturers to stay ahead.

  1. The Rise of Prefabricated Construction: Prefabrication is increasingly popular due to its cost-efficiency, speed, and reduced labor demands. Highlight how roll forming machines are perfectly suited for this trend, enabling manufacturers to produce steel decking with precision, speed, and consistency. This ensures they can meet the growing demand for prefabricated components.
  2. Customization for Modern Projects: As more complex architectural designs emerge, steel decking profiles must adapt. Roll forming machines can produce customized profiles quickly, allowing manufacturers to offer a variety of decking solutions that meet the unique specifications of modern construction projects.
  3. Sustainability and Efficiency: Steel decking is valued for its recyclability and durability. Roll forming machines contribute to this trend by optimizing material usage, reducing waste, and supporting sustainable practices. As environmental standards become more stringent, these machines help manufacturers stay compliant while remaining competitive.
  4. Automation and Technological Integration: Modern roll forming machines are equipped with advanced automation, which minimizes manual intervention and maximizes production efficiency. As labor shortages and rising costs affect the construction industry, automated roll forming machines give manufacturers a competitive edge by reducing production time and human error.
  5. Improving Supply Chain Responsiveness: With the construction industry's fast-paced environment, manufacturers need to respond quickly to changing project demands. Roll forming machines offer the flexibility to ramp up production or adjust product lines swiftly, ensuring that steel decking manufacturers can keep up with tight project deadlines and fluctuating market conditions.
